Without wishing to open the irrelevant old debate, I often wonder why the Holden engined Cobras don't figure more prominently in these tables. Surely they are on average more powerful and lighter, equally modifiable ....

Is it the driver factor mainly, or just that fewer GM cars are racing at these events?

Fewer LS Cars - ford cars been around longer and have had greater development - A few more "serious" racer folk among the ford cars. I think if you were to look at the results over the years, there would be a representation of gen3\4 cars that is proportional to the number that is out there. I think two gen3 cars have taken out the overall shelbyfest trophy out of the 8 years. Less than 25% of the cars entering are Gen 3/4. LS cobras have taken out King and queen cobra previously. I dont think there is a great disparity, but at the moment there are a few Ford guys that are in another league from all of us (Other Fords and Chev engined cobras) - and they are a lot of fun to watch!
